 Logger Check via SSH

Purpose: Check if Logger is active, EC data arrive at the Logger, EC data are written to a file and if EC data files were generated for the last 7 days.

  1. SSH: establish SSH connection to the data logger (e.g. LANNER)
  2. sonicshow: check if sonic data are incoming with command sonicshow
  3. irgashow / lgrshow / qclshow: check if IRGA / LGR / QCL data are incoming with command irgashow or lgrshow or qclshow NOTE! Please also check LGR and QCL data in this step.
  4. showstatus: check how much of the disk space on the logger is used (100% means no disk space left), run command showstatus and fill in the number shown under Use%
  5. filesize: check if filesize of newest EC file is increasing, e.g. for CH-FRU with command ls -l *.X* (the file extension of the EC binary files are starting with X)
  6. files: check if there are EC data files available for the last 7 days

Meteo Check in Grafana Dashboards

Purpose: For the last 30 days or longer: check if important meteo variables (6+3) look OK. Check if all other variables look OK.

  • We check meteo raw data using Grafana dashboards. They show data that are available on GL-RAW (where we store all our raw data) and were successfully uploaded to the database.
  • If a plot in the dashboard shows data gaps, then most likely the respective data file is really missing on our server GL-RAW.
  • If data are still stored in some temporary folder (i.e. not in the respective data type and site folder, e.g. 10_meteo in CH-OE2 on GL-RAW) then data are not plotted and missing from the database and therefore from the dashboard.

Flux Check in DIIVE or Grafana Dashboards

Purpose: For the last 30 days or longer: check if unrotated wind aggregates look OK, check if fluxes for H, CO2 and H2O look OK.

  • During the year we calculate Level-0 (preliminary) fluxes using FLUXRUN with EddyPro.
  • EddyPro outputs two results files: the traditional _full_output_ file (can be directly loaded in diive v0.21.0, and the newer _fluxnet_ file (these are shown in the Grafana Dashboards), whereby the latter file contains many more variables than the former.
  • Both files can be used to check recent fluxes and wind components.
  1. Check if unrotated wind variables u, v, w are between +/- 5 m s-1:
    • The name of the unrotated wind variables is U_UNROT, V_UNROT and W_UNROT in the _fluxnet_ file and u_unrot, v_unrot and w_unrot in the _full_output_ file.
  2. Check if fluxes look as expected.
    • The name of the sensible heat flux variable is H in the _fluxnet_ file and in the _full_output_ file.
    • The name of the CO2 flux variable is FC in the _fluxnet_ file and co2_flux in the _full_output_ file.
    • The name of the H2O flux variable is FH2O in the _fluxnet_ file and h2o_flux in the _full_output_ file.
